The grandeur of the Pena Palace is often the first stop for visitors. This colorful Romanticist castle sits atop a hill, offering panoramic views of the surrounding landscape. Constructed in the 19th century, its vibrant facades and eclectic architectural styles make it one of the most iconic landmarks in Portugal. Walking through its ornate rooms, visitors can appreciate the opulence that once embraced the Portuguese royalty.
Not far from Pena Palace, the Quinta da Regaleira delights visitors with its magical gardens and intriguing initiatic well. This estate is steeped in symbolism and mysticism, drawing inspiration from the Knights Templar and the Rosicrucian Order. Wandering through its secret tunnels and lush gardens feels like a journey through another world. The estate's elaborate architecture, combined with its alluring gardens, makes it a must-visit.
The Monserrate Palace is another gem, known for its exotic designs and romantic gardens. Built in the 19th century, this villa features a unique blend of Gothic, Indian, and Moorish influences, making it a visual masterpiece. The gardens are as impressive as the palace itself, showcasing a variety of flora from around the world. Visitors can spend hours exploring this enchanting space, taking in the creative landscaping that enhances the beauty of the estate.
For those interested in more traditional architecture, the Palace of Sintra offers a glimpse into the town's rich history. With its distinctive chimneys and medieval design, this palace served as the residence for the Portuguese royal family. Visitors can marvel at the beautifully decorated interiors and learn about the fascinating history of the Portuguese monarchy.
As you explore these stunning villas and estates, don't forget to take a leisurely stroll through Sintra's Historic Center. This UNESCO World Heritage site is filled with charming streets, local shops, and authentic eateries where you can indulge in traditional Portuguese pastries like travesseiros and queijadas.
